* One late episode of ''Series/{{Frasier}}'' is dedicated to the main characters' anxiety dreams — Frasier dreams that Roz is berating him because his radio booth is full of cobwebs and no one has called in six months, reflecting his worries that his show might be declining as well as his fear of being alone, Niles dreams about accidentally baking his unborn baby into a pie, reflecting his fear that he's going to be a bad father, and Daphne dreams about inflating comically while Niles cheats on her with several supermodels, reflecting her fear that motherhood and age will affect her marriage. Martin, on the other hand, just dreams about singing and dancing with his new girlfriend in the style of Fred Astaire and Ginger Rogers — without his cane.

Unlike BadDreams, this can and usually is overcome by [[FaceYourFears doing the dreaded thing, or getting past it]]. Except where they are one and the same, fueled by a fear of facing MyGreatestFailure again -- in which case facing it will still fix the dreams. Unusually likely to be AllJustADream.

This trope is to DreamingOfThingsToCome as BadDreams is to DreamingOfTimesGoneBy.
